Canned bean liquid is usually gross and better substituted with something … Web11 apr. 2024 · Open the can of green beans. Pour into a colander to drain. Rinse the green beans under tap water, then let it sit in the colander to drain for up to 2 mins. Transfer green beans to air fryer basket or tray and air fry at 350°F (180°C) got 4 to 6 mins. Toss in melted butter, garlic and black pepper till well coated.
